Jagapathi Babu and Anoop Rubens appeared together in 3 Telugu films between 2014 and 2017. Their highest-rated collaboration was Ism (2016 — 7.5/10). Films span Pilla Nuvvu Leni Jeevitham (2014) through Hello (2017).

Where each was in their career

38% of Anoop Rubens's screen credits are with Jagapathi Babu. When they first worked together, Jagapathi Babu had 53 films behind them; Anoop Rubens had 2. After Hello, Jagapathi Babu kept going for 20 more films; Anoop Rubens stepped back.

Jagapathi Babu

Before Pilla Nuvvu Leni Jeevitham, Jagapathi Babu had starred in 53 films, including Kushi Kushiga (2004) and Homam (2008).

After Hello, Jagapathi Babu went on to appear in 20 more films, including Pushpa (The Rise Part-01) (2021) and Yatra (2019).

Anoop Rubens

Before Pilla Nuvvu Leni Jeevitham, Anoop Rubens had starred in 2 films, including Jaffa (2013) and Lovely (2012).

After Hello, Anoop Rubens went on to appear in 3 more films, including Bangarraju (2022) and 90 ML (2019).
